Abstract:
The alloying of Ru with rare-earth elements (REEs) is an effective approach for the modification of the electronic structure of Ru. Here, for the first time, we report the formation of Ru-M (M = La or Y) alloys that are endowed with a completely new type of active sites. Over the Ru-M (M = La or Y) catalysts, N-2 activation in ammonia synthesis follows neither the well-known dissociative nor the associative route but rather a co-operation of both, leading to outstanding performance. The developed RuLa/HZ catalyst exhibits a NH3 synthesis rate of 14.73 mmol gcat(-1) h(-1) at 400 degrees C and 1 MPa without obvious deactivation in a run of 1756 h (ca.73 days).
